Discography
Scott's first released Single was a song called Throw that Ball Ya'all (Available on amazonmp3.com). the song is a biography of the career of Brett Favre prior to him leaving Green Bay.
First album released: Love Notes: Scott's first album was released on CD in February of 2011. Most popular songs include, My Best Friend and My Wife, Kickapoo Valley, and Lookin' for Beaver.
His Second CD: Locally Famous (Widely Unknown) was released in June of 2011. Most popular songs include, Locally Famous, Hippy Chick and Heart of Gold.
Second single released: Scott's song he wrote for Oprah Winfrey and sang it on her lifeclass show, was released in October of 2011.
Released Third CD: Scott's Christmas Cd A Little Jing-a-Ling was released in December of 2011. Most popular songs include, Christmas Time, Comin' home and Must Be Somethin' More.
Fourth CD Release: Scott's CD called the Road is a true Americana blues CD with songs like, Holiday Road, Germany in '43 and Fly. It also features a cameo of his Daughter Laura's new song called, The Way That I Am.

Bio
Americana blues songwriter Scott Wilcox has produced four albums, appeared on the Oprah Winfrey Lifeclass Show, won the Bob Dylan Songwriting Competition, appeared on many midwest media and performed all over the Midwest. In Scott's music you'll hear a little bit of Motown, a little bit of the blues, and a little bit of Wisconsin Americana.
In October of 2011, Scott performed his song called, When You Know Better, live on the Oprah Winfrey Lifeclass program for 45 million viewers. Oprah, a proud owner of all of Scott's albums, called Scott's music "fantastic" and his talent a true "gift".
